Motorola reveals third-party applications for Android devices

Android Motorola Logos To innovate its Android driven devices, Motorola recently announced modern third-party solutions for its imminent portfolio of mobile devices powered by the Google OS.

By means of its partner ecosystem, Motorola allows users to extend and personalize their mobile device experiences via pre-loaded, embedded or downloaded applications on the Android driven devices.

“Motorola’s ecosystem partners around Android have developed signature applications that consumers increasingly expect with their mobile device. Working closely with these companies allows us to provide a compelling mobile Android-based experience that satisfies specific consumer needs,” remarked Christy Wyatt, vice president, software applications and ecosystem, Motorola Mobile Devices.

“At AccuWeather.com, we are strong believers in the power of social media to connect people and share timely information. That’s why we’re so pleased to offer the most accurate weather forecasts on the Motorola CLIQ. Our home screen widget pushes current weather to the Motorola CLIQ and gives one-click access to forecasts, so users can monitor their favorite social media and get their forecasts in real time without missing a beat,” stated Jim Candor, Senior Vice President of New Media, Accuweather.

Signature applications are also designed which enable users to personalize their handsets according to their lifestyle. The most recent Motorola invention, the Android driven Cliq with Motoblur facilitates users to access content, multi-media offerings and stay connected through applications from partners such as Accuweather, Amazon MP3, Barnes & Noble, CardStar, Comcast Entertainment Group, Hands On Mobile and many more.

Further, Motorola offers extensive market reach to the developers via MOTODEV that presents a streamlined path into multiple distribution channels including Android Market and operator channels.
